Just how far can Dame Valerie Adams throw a gumboot? We're about to find out.
The Olympic shot put champion will chance her arm at some very different sports next month at the Hilux New Zealand Rural Games in Palmerston North.
Dame Valerie is back in New Zealand ahead of the international season that will see her defend her 2016 IAAF Diamond Race victory, the fifth of her hugely successful career.
She will attend the Hilux-sponsored Games on March 11 and 12 in her capacity as a Toyota ambassador. The weekend event is being held on The Square and features national and trans-Tasman championships for traditional sports like speed shearing and wood chopping alongside fun contests for spectators including speed milking, hay stacking and wine barrel racing. Entry to the event is free.
It is likely once formalities of the opening ceremony are complete, Dame Valerie may even try her hand at some of the events up against the nation's finest. It is also hoped that she will drop by the Toyota marquee to meet spectators.
